With the blooming development of world trade In the1990’s, green trade barrierswere generally risen in countries, especially in developed countries. An export has beengreatly affected in disadvantage developing countries. In recent years, green trade barriersare increasingly heavy in developed countries: an environmental requirement is morestringent, the standard of inspection and quarantine is higher. Since China joined the WTO,export markets of China’s agriculture have been broader. Also, our agricultural products’export is severely affected by the green trade barriers. So, these have brought opportunitiesand challenges for Chinese development. For now, there are many problems in the exportof agricultural products, which reduces the international competitiveness of exports ofagricultural products. For example, the export’s structure is irrational, agricultural productsis low value-added; export market is concentration, etc. Only when these issues weresolved, was the export of agricultural products promoted, and the competitive advantage ofagricultural export enhanced.This paper analyzes the causes and current situation of China’s agricultural productexports in green trade barriers’ situation. This paper calculates the advantages andcompetitiveness of agricultural exports by citing the index evaluation method, andIdentifies the advantages projects of China’s agricultural exports. In addition, this paperestimates the green trade barriers’ impact of China’s vegetable export to Japan marketthrough empirical analysis. Finally, according to the influencing factors, this paperproposes some suggestions to cope with green trade barriers. There are some greattheoretical and practical significance for the study of agricultural trade.
